Key Responsibilities
- Support the administration and maintenance of the Quality Management System (QMS) in accordance with applicable standards (e.g. ISO 9001, IATF 16949)
- Assist in document control activities, including creation, revision, distribution, and archival of controlled documents
- Ensure quality records are properly maintained, traceable, and readily accessible
- Assist in planning and supporting audits
- Track audit findings, action items, and closure status
- Support preparation of audit evidence and documentation
- Assist in investigation of quality issues and root cause analysis
- Track Corrective and Preventive Actions (CAPA) to ensure timely and effective closure
- Collect, compile, and analyze quality data (e.g. audit results, CAPA status, KPIs)
- Prepare quality reports and dashboards for management review
- Maintain quality performance metrics and trend analysis
